Before any physical work begins, a qualified electrician must carry out a comprehensive evaluation of your residential or commercial property's existing electrical infrastructure to determine whether it can safely support an EV charger installation. Older homes throughout Sydney's inner suburbs, in particular, often have ageing switchboards that were never designed to accommodate the extra load that comes with electrical lorry charging. In these cases, a switchboard upgrade becomes a required requirement, adding to the total project scope but substantially enhancing the security and reliability of the whole electrical system while doing so. The assessment stage likewise consists of recognizing the most ideal place for the charging system, considering elements such as cable routing range, weatherproofing requirements, and ease of gain access to for everyday use. The type of charger chosen for your EV charger installation will have a direct bearing on how rapidly your vehicle charges and just how much the general project costs. For a lot of Sydney households, a Level 2 air conditioning charger more info operating on a 32-amp dedicated circuit represents the most practical and economical solution, capable of providing a full charge over night for the vast bulk of electrical vehicle designs presently on the marketplace. Level 1 charging through a basic 10-amp power point is technically possible but commonly considered insufficient for day-to-day driving needs offered how gradually it renews the battery. DC quick chargers, while remarkably quick, are prohibitively expensive for home installation and are better matched to commercial settings such as shopping center, service stations, and fleet depots. Discussing your particular lorry design, daily kilometre range, and future-proofing objectives with your installer makes sure the EV charger installation is sized and set up properly for your situations instead of just defaulting to the most inexpensive offered alternative.
Every Sydney homeowner must understand the regulative landscape that governs EV charger installations in New South Wales before any work starts. All electrical work must follow the AS/NZS 3000 electrical wiring code, and depending on the job's size and intricacy, a notice or approval from the suitable authority may be needed. Just a certified electrician is licensed by law to perform this work, and a certificate of compliance must be provided upon completion to verify that the installation satisfies all relevant standards. Homeowners who try to cut costs by employing unlicensed labor risk invalidating their home insurance, incurring large fines, and developing real safety dangers for their family and property.
